How much will a 2023 bZ4X set you back?

Price of a 2023 Toyota bZ4X The Manufacturer’s Suggested Retail Price (MSRP) for a 2023 bZ4X XLE with front-wheel drive is $42,000 plus a $1,215 destination fee. Starting at $46,700 is the Limited trim. For the second electric motor that enables all-wheel drive, add $2,080 to both amounts.

Can I order a Toyota bZ4X in advance?

The bZ4X electric SUV will be available for pre-order or reservation through Toyota USA soon, months before local dealers receive the vehicle in the middle of 2022. There will be a $500 refundable reservation deposit needed. After completing the first stage, your local Toyota dealer will get in touch with you to confirm your order. Based on your Zip Code or the Zip Code of the dealership you are buying from, a Toyota dealer will be given to you.

Can I buy bZ4X in the USA?

This spring, retailers in the United States will start selling Toyota’s bZ4X, the company’s first entirely battery-electric passenger car, for $42,000. At $48,780, the AWD limited edition is the most expensive.

Both front-wheel drive (FWD) and all-wheel drive (AWD) versions of the bZ4X electric SUV will be made available. While the all-wheel-drive version combines two electric drives with a combined 80 kW, the front-wheel-drive version has a 150 kW drive. The bZ4X generates 201 horsepower for front-wheel drive and 214 horsepower for all-wheel drive. FWD and AWD are predicted to accelerate from 0 to 60 mph in 7.1 and 6.5 seconds, respectively.

The XLE FWD model offers a range rating of up to 252 miles, according to EPA estimates. The EPA estimates the range of the XLE AWD model to be up to 228 miles. Both 120V and 240V chargers as well as DC fast-chargers can be used for charging. A J1772/CCS1 connector is available on all bZ4X versions, enabling both at-home and public charging. With a Level 2 charger, the bZ4X can charge from low to full in around 9 hours thanks to its onboard 6.6 kW charger, while a fast charger should only need 30 minutes to charge from 0% to 80%.

Customers who buy or lease a new 2023 Toyota bZ4X are entitled to one year of unlimited free charging at any EVgo-owned and operated public charging stations nationwide for use when charging away from home. The Toyota App provides access to the chargers as well as information about their locations.

How durable are electric vehicles?

An electric vehicle obtains its power straight from a large pack of batteries, as opposed to internal combustion engined cars, which get their energy from burning gasoline or fuel.

These resemble an enlarged version of the lithium-ion (Li-ion) battery in your smartphone; however, electric vehicles (EVs) use packs made up of thousands of individual Li-ion cells that cooperate to power the vehicle. Electricity is utilized to change the batteries’ chemical composition while the car is charging. These modifications are then reversed when the vehicle is in motion to create electricity.

Electric car battery technology

While driving, EV batteries go through cycles of “discharge,” and they “charge,” when the car is plugged in. The battery’s ability to keep a charge is affected by how often you repeat this operation. As a result, the distance between charges and the time between trips are reduced. The majority of manufacturers offer a battery guarantee of five to eight years. A battery for an electric vehicle, however, is currently expected to last 1020 years before needing to be replaced.

It’s surprisingly easy to understand how a battery and the car’s electric motor function together.

The wheels are driven by electric motors that are connected to the battery. When you step on the gas, the car immediately supplies the motor with power, which progressively uses up the energy stored in the batteries.

When you release the accelerator, the automobile starts to slow down by turning its forward momentum back into power thanks to the fact that electric motors can also function as generators. This effect is amplified if you apply the brakes. By recovering energy that would otherwise be lost during braking, regenerative braking increases battery life and extends the travel distance of an automobile.

Electric car battery lithium-ion

Electric vehicles and a variety of portable electronics employ lithium-ion (Li-ion) batteries, a type of rechargeable battery. Compared to normal lead-acid or nickel-cadmium rechargeable batteries, they have a higher energy density. As a result, the size of the battery pack as a whole can be decreased by battery makers.

The lightest of all metals is lithium. However, lithium-ion (Li-ion) batteries only have ions and not lithium metal. Ions are atoms or molecules having an electric charge brought on by the loss or gain of one or more electrons, for those who are unsure of what an ion is.

In addition to being safer than many alternatives, lithium-ion batteries must also have safety precautions in place to safeguard consumers in the unlikely case of a battery failure. To protect the batteries during frequent, rapid charging sessions that take place quickly, manufacturers, for example, install charging protections in electric vehicles.

Do Electric Cars Make Sense?

Initially, electric automobiles are more expensive than gas-powered ones. According to Kelley Blue Book, the average cost of an EV is $56,437, which is about $5,000 more expensive than the average cost of a base-model, high-end, gas-powered car. However, the gas savings might offset the difference in sticker price. According to a Consumer Reports study, fuel costs are about 60% lower for EV users than for drivers of gas-powered vehicles. According to CNBC, the entire cost of a gas-powered automobile would be $94,540 over the course of its 200,000-mile lifespan, whereas the cost of an equivalent EV would be $90,160.

Additionally, federal tax incentives that can reduce the cost of your vehicle by as much as $7,500 are helping to cut the sticker price of EVs. Additionally, because to advancements in battery and technology, EVs should become much more affordable in the upcoming years.

How long does it take an electric car to charge?

An electric car can be charged in as little as 30 minutes or as long as 12 hours. This is dependent on the battery size and charging point speed.

  • With a 50kW rapid charger, you can extend the range of many electric vehicles by up to 100 miles in around 35 minutes.
  • It takes longer to charge your automobile from empty to full the larger the battery and the slower the charging point.
  • With a 7kW charging station, it takes an average electric car (60kWh battery) just under 8 hours to go from empty to full.
  • Instead of letting their batteries to recharge from empty to full, the majority of drivers choose to top it off.

Recommendation: Charging an electric automobile is comparable to charging a cell phone; you top it off as needed throughout the day and fully charge it at home over night.

Where is the Toyota bZ4X manufactured?

Toyota produces the battery-powered Toyota bZ4X, a small crossover SUV. The car had its public premiere as the “bZ4X Concept” in April 2021. It is the first car to be built on the e-TNGA platform, which Toyota and Subaru jointly developed[7]; it is also the first Toyota model to be included in the Toyota bZ (“beyond Zero”) series of zero-emissions cars. Production of the bZ4X is slated to take place in China and Japan, with global sales beginning in mid-2022.

The “bZ4X” nameplate has two distinct meanings, according to Toyota: “bZ” denotes that it is a battery-electric vehicle that emits “beyond Zero” emissions; and “4X” designates that it is a compact crossover SUV, with its number digit taken from the comparable-sized RAV4.

Does Subaru produce electric vehicles?

In the middle of the 2020s, Subaru will start producing its own EVs alongside internal combustion engines at its Yajima factory in Japan. Subaru’s Oizumi plant, where engines and transmissions are currently produced, will become the site of a special electric vehicle production starting around 2027.

What Tesla model is the cheapest?

The Tesla Model 3 is the most affordable Tesla available right now. Their website states that the standard rear-wheel-drive Model 3 can be ordered for $48,190, including destination, before incentives. As a result of the most recent round of Tesla pricing increases, it is $2,000 more expensive than it was earlier this year.
